#CECDDD Hex Color Code

#CECDDD

The Hexadecimal Color #CECDDD is a contrast shade of Light Gray. #CECDDD RGB value is rgb(206, 205, 221). RGB Color Model of #CECDDD consists of 80% red, 80% green and 86% blue. HSL color Mode of #CECDDD has 244°(degrees) Hue, 19% Saturation and 84% Lightness. #CECDDD color has an wavelength of 466.37037nm approximately. The nearest Web Safe Color of #CECDDD is #FFFFFF. The Closest Small Hexadecimal Code of #CECDDD is #CCD. The Closest Color to #CECDDD is #D3D3D3. Official Name of #CECDDD Hex Code is Ghost. CMYK (Cyan Magenta Yellow Black) of #CECDDD is 7 Cyan 7 Magenta 0 Yellow 13 Black and #CECDDD CMY is 7, 7, 0. HSLA (Hue Saturation Lightness Alpha) of #CECDDD is hsl(244,19,84, 1.0) and HSV is hsv(244, 7, 87). A Three-Dimensional XYZ value of #CECDDD is 60.33, 62.0, 77.18.
Hex8 Value of #CECDDD is #CECDDDFF. Decimal Value of #CECDDD is 13553117 and Octal Value of #CECDDD is 63546735. Binary Value of #CECDDD is 11001110, 11001101, 11011101 and Android of #CECDDD is 4291743197 / 0xffcecddd. The Horseshoe Shaped Chromaticity Diagram xyY of #CECDDD is 0.302, 0.311, 0.311 and YIQ Color Space of #CECDDD is 207.123, -4.5449, 5.1907. The Color Space LMS (Long Medium Short) of #CECDDD is 58.31, 63.27, 76.92. CieLAB (L*a*b*) of #CECDDD is 82.91, 3.35, -7.78. CieLUV : LCHuv (L*, u*, v*) of #CECDDD is 82.91, -0.36, -12.58. The cylindrical version of CieLUV is known as CieLCH : LCHab of #CECDDD is 82.91, 8.47, 293.3. Hunter Lab variable of #CECDDD is 78.74, -1.03, -3.0.

Triad, Tetrad and SplitComplement of #CECDDD

Triad, Tetrad, and Split Complement are hex color schemes used in art to create harmonious combinations of colors.

The Triad color scheme involves three colors that are evenly spaced around the color wheel, forming an equilateral triangle. The primary triad includes red, blue, and yellow, while other triadic combinations can be formed with different hues. Triad color schemes offer a balanced contrast and are versatile for creating vibrant and dynamic visuals.

The Tetrad color scheme incorporates four colors that are arranged in two complementary pairs. These pairs create a rectangle or square shape on the color wheel. The primary Tetrad includes two sets of complementary colors, such as red and green, and blue and orange. This scheme provides a wide range of color options and allows for both strong contrast and harmonious blends.

The Split Complement color scheme involves a base color paired with the two colors adjacent to its complementary color on the color wheel. For example, if the base color is blue, the Split Complement scheme would include blue, yellow-orange, and red-orange. This combination maintains contrast while offering a more subtle and balanced alternative to a complementary color scheme.
